What is a habit?

Habits + Deliberate Practice = Perfect”



Habits are mental shortcuts. A habit is a routine or behavior that is performed repeatedly and most of the time automatically. When you face a problem repeatedly, your brain starts doing the process of solving it. Your habits are a set of automated solutions that solve the problems you face regularly. The ultimate aim of habits is to solve life’s problems with as little energy and effort as possible. A habit is a behavior that has been repeated enough times to become automatic. How do habits work?


Hints -> longing -> feedback -> rewards

The main components of habit formation are:

1. Signal: It prompts your brain to start a behavior.  It’s a little bit of information that predicts the reward.

2. Craving: It is the motivation behind every habit.  Without the will, we have no reason to act.

3. Feedback: It’s the same habit you play;  It can take the form of a thought or action.

4. Reward: The ultimate goal of every habit

Habit formation is the process by which a behavior becomes progressively more automatic through repetition.  How long you’ve been doing a habit isn’t as important as how many times you’ve done it. You can do something three times in thirty days or three hundred times.  Frequency will always make a difference. How to start a new habit?

After [current habit], I will take [new habit].’

One of the best ways to create a new habit is to identify the current habit you already do every day and then top your new behavior on top.  This is called habit stacking.  The two most common signs are time and place.  Creating an intention to implement is a strategy you can use to associate a new habit with a specific time and place.  Habit stacking is a strategy you can use to associate a new habit with an existing habit

The formula for adding a habit is:

After [the present habit], I will take [the new habit].’

Surya Namaskar is made up of 12 yoga asanas

1• Pranamasana

Stand straight facing the sun and join both legs, keeping the waist straight. Now bring the hands near the chest and make a state of bowing by joining both palms.

2. Hasta Uttanasana – (Raised Arms Pose)

Stand in the first position and raise your hands above the head and keep it straight. Now move the hands backwards in the state of bowing and bend the waist backwards.

3. Padahastasana – (Standing Forward Bend)

Now exhale slowly and touch the toes of the feet with hands while bending forward. At this time your head should meet the knees. 

4. Ashwa Sanchalanasana (Equestrian Pose)

Breathe slowly and stretch the straight leg backwards. The knee of the straight leg should meet the ground. Now bend the other leg from the knee and keep the palms straight on the ground. Keep the head towards the sky.

5. Dandasana (Staff Pose)

Now while exhaling, keep both hands and feet in a straight line and come to the position of push-up.

6. Ashtanga Namaskara – Eight Limbed pose or Caterpillar pose

Now while breathing, join your palms, chest, knees and feet to the ground. Stay in this position and hold the breath. 

7. Bhujangasana (Cobra Pose)

Now place the palms on the ground and tilt the head back towards the sky as much as possible while joining the stomach to the ground.

8. Adho Mukha Svanasana – (Downward-facing Dog Pose)

It is also called Parvatasana. For its practice, keep your legs straight on the ground and raise the hip upwards. While exhaling, keep the shoulders straight and the head inwards.

9. Ashwa Sanchalanasana (Equestrian Pose)

Breathe slowly and stretch the straight leg backwards. The knee of the straight leg should meet the ground. Now bend the other leg from the knee and keep the palms straight on the ground. Keep the head towards the sky.

10. Padahastasana – (Hand Under Foot Pose)

Now exhale slowly and touch the toes of the feet with hands while bending forward. At this time your head should be met with the knees

11• Hastuttanasana (Raised Arms Pose)

Stand in the first position and raise your hands above the head and keep it straight. Now move the hands backwards in the state of bowing and bend the waist backwards. During this time you will make the shape of a half moon. This asana is also called Ardhachandrasana.

12. Pranamasana – The Prayer Pose

Stand straight facing the sun and join both legs, keeping the waist straight. Now bring the hands near the chest and make a state of bowing by joining both palms. .

What is a mantra?

The term “mantra” originates from two Sanskrit roots, namely ‘manas’ which signifies the mind, and ‘tra’ which denotes an instrument. Essentially, a mantra functions as a tool of the mind, producing a potent sound or vibration that facilitates deep meditation. In mantra yoga, faith and devotion to the mantra’s deity are crucial elements that unlock its transformative potential.

Every mantra encompasses three essential components, known as limbs or “Angas”:

1. Devata:
This refers to the deity who is revered and praised by the mantra.

2. Rishi:
The seer or sage to whom the mantra was originally revealed.

3. Chandah:
The specific meter or poetic structure in which the mantra is composed.

1. Mood and Emotions The moon is associated with emotions, feelings, and the mind. It influences our moods and mental states. It is believed to govern the subtle, emotional aspect of human nature.

2. Soma, the Divine Nectar In Vedic texts, Soma is often referred to as a divine nectar or elixir associated with the moon. It is considered a source of spiritual enlightenment and higher consciousness.

3. Cycles and Rhythms The moon’s phases have deep significance. The waxing and waning of the moon are seen as reflections of the cyclical nature of life, death, and rebirth.

4. Feminine Energy The moon is associated with feminine energy and is often linked with goddesses like Saraswati, Parvati, and Lakshmi in Hindu mythology. It embodies qualities like nurturing, receptivity, and intuition.

5. Meditative Practices The moon is considered an aid in meditation. Its calming influence on the mind is utilized in practices aimed at achieving inner peace and spiritual growth.

6. Astrology In Vedic astrology (Jyotish Shastra), the position of the moon at the time of one’s birth (Moon sign or “Chandra Rashi”) is believed to influence a person’s personality, emotions, and inner nature.

7. Deity Chandra Chandra is also considered a deity in Hinduism. He is often depicted as riding a chariot pulled by ten white horses, representing the ten directions in Hindu cosmology.

8. Soma Sacrifices In ancient Vedic rituals, Soma was an essential element in sacrificial ceremonies. Its consumption was believed to confer spiritual enlightenment and a sense of euphoria.
